我正在尝试将我的 Debian 服务器(从 返回的版本 6.0.3 lsb_release
)从内核 2.6.8 更新到 2.6.32,但它一直说我的网络驱动程序是 tg3,尽管我在 /etc/modprobe.d/blacklist 中创建了 tg3 黑名单,但
它应该使用 e1000
我该如何设置?
我不可能在不久的将来接近服务器,所以我必须创建一个脚本,然后可以在启动时或通过 cron 运行,如果我无法在配置文件中设置它
编辑我弄清楚了由于ethtool
总线的原因,当要设置两个网络接口时,它们的编号发生了变化,但我仍然不明白为什么接口无法启动。我为两个接口创建了相同的配置/etc/network/interfaces
答案1
我不确定您当前的 Debian 版本,但较新的版本需要/etc/modprobe.d/yourmodulename.conf
通过添加如下行将模块列入黑名单:
blacklist yourmodulename
.conf
现在似乎需要扩展。实际上,我希望这就是问题所在。
答案2
我仍然不知道如何“重命名”网络接口,但它可以为两个接口创建相同的配置